Below are the steps to solve an equation:
Step 1: |x - 2| + 3 = 7
Step 2: |x - 2| = 7 - 3
Step 3: |x - 2| = 4
Which of the following is a correct next step to solve the equation?
A) x + 2 = -4
B) -x - 2 = 4
C) x + 2 = 4
D) x - 2 = -4

please I rewrite:
case 1)
\[x-2\ge 0\]
then your equation can be rewritten as below:
\[x-2=4\]
case 2) \[x-2< 0\]
then your equation can be rewritten as below:
\[-x+2=4\]
